I know there is the ability to change the tracking interval by time, but it would be nice to also have an option to be able to set it by distance. E.g. 6ft between points, regardless of time travelled. I use the GPS tracking for mountain biking, and in some places I can be travelling at over 30 mph for maybe a minute - obviously this covers great distance with few points, so loses accuracy, but then when I am going up a hill on tough terrain at maybe 4 mph, it creates a lot of points for a short distance! I think if I could set it by distance I would get a more accurate recording and perhaps less points for the total track?

This minimum distance already exists in AlpineQuest (since long), but cannot be changed by the user. It is linked to the refresh rate like that:

rate (loc/sec), minimum distance (m)
1, 0
2, 1
5, 2
10, 3
20, 6
40, 12
60, 18

Hi,
You can see this rate in the Geolocation window: on the top right, just under the activate button.
Click on it to change the value.
The same rate is used by the GPS location tracker.
